kaaass / ZerotierFix

An unofficial Zerotier Android client patched from official client
GNU General Public License v2.0
1.67k stars 193 forks source link

1.10.x alpha 版小米 11 pro 机型 (MIUI 12.5) 无法连接 #46

Closed brdctrai closed 1 year ago

brdctrai commented 1 year ago

小米11pro应用最新alpha版状态是已断开,无法连接,用ZeroTierOne1.10.apk是正常使用。在红米k20 MIUI版本12.5.2都可正常使用。 小米11pro MIUI版本是miui 12.5.20. YHIWHG%PNA%G)QZ{M1C(MZX

brdctrai commented 1 year ago

无论在wifi和移动网络都无法连接。 U{}PN63IGW 897OL }GZZ9T

kaaass commented 1 year ago

我好像没太懂,是同 MIUI 版本但是型号不同的两部机器,其中小米 11 PRO 无法连接但是红米 k20 可以连接?

brdctrai commented 1 year ago

小米11pro用ZeroTierOne1.10.apk是正常使用

kaaass commented 1 year ago

好的,感谢报告!

目前我找了一圈,只找到一台小米 10s 的 MIUI 14 设备,测试可以正常连接。但是因为机型和系统版本都不一样,所以目前只能大致确定是特殊机型/特殊系统版本的问题。不过由于目前我没有这个型号的机器,也暂时不能复现所以也没法做什么调试了。本 Issue 就先保持这个状态看看还有没有其他类似机型的报告吧。建议 @brdctrai 也可以尝试下其他网络环境是否能连接,或者有什么特殊条件与该问题相关,比如安装了什么 APP 有功能冲突。

xzl0326 commented 1 year ago

你这个bug好像和我之前那个差不多。你试试先开一个VPN应用连接再切回zerotierfix再启动

Aes64X commented 1 year ago

额。。。这个1.10.x alpha 确实是有些问题,在我的三桑A53上使用,他不会申请任何权限,不申请VPN权限,也不联网,打开允许移动网络使用,载流量监测里面甚至看不到这个版本使用任何流量。WLAN下也不进行任何连接。 但在使用1.0.5_189时是会正常申请VPN权限,通知,联网也正常动作。 Android 13

kaaass commented 1 year ago

@Aes64X 感谢报告!这个似乎是一个新的问题,不知道是否介意开个 issue 然后详细的说明下情况?不过 VPN 权限的话,如果旧版本有授权新版本应该不会再次请求。

xzl0326 commented 1 year ago

@Aes64X 感谢报告!这个似乎是一个新的问题,不知道是否介意开个 issue 然后详细的说明下情况?不过 VPN 权限的话,如果旧版本有授权新版本应该不会再次请求。

对,我也发现了。如果全新安装的话就不会申请VPN权限。

kaaass commented 1 year ago

新版本 1.0.7_011006_alpha 目前包含了 #48 提及的问题,可否麻烦 @brdctrai 再试试是否仍存在无法连接的问题?

xzl0326 commented 1 year ago

@kaaass 刚刚试了1.0.7的版本,VPN权限申请是正常了。不过我反馈的那个问题依旧存在。就是不显示连接配置信息

brdctrai commented 1 year ago

新版本 1.0.7_011006_alpha 目前包含了 #48 提及的问题,可否麻烦 @brdctrai 再试试是否仍存在无法连接的问题?

经过测试可以正常连接,问题可以关闭,谢谢!

kaaass commented 1 year ago

@xzl0326 感谢测试!不过这个问题需要重写 VPN 状态与 UI 的通信逻辑,修复起来需要一些时间,我之后再找时间看看。后续相关进展都在 #44 这个 Issue 更新。

kaaass commented 1 year ago

@brdctrai 好的,感谢测试!